The McIntosh RAA1 Remote Antenna is designed to im-
prove the AM reception in any installation, especially if the
tuner or A/V unit is located in a noisy reception area. Place
the RAA1 away from all interference sources such as AC
power cords and florescent lights, etc. Rotate the antenna
in any direction necessary to reduce interference and re-
ceive maximum signal strength.
Notes:
1. The RAAI Remote AM Antenna of your MX132 has been
factory adjusted for optimum reception in a typical
urban location. If you wish to customize the antenna for
the best possible performance in your location, have
your installer perform the two adjustment operations
listed below.
2. An additional long line AM antenna or external ground
can be connected to the GND and ANT terminals if
desired.
3. Refer to Tuner Functions in the How to Operation the
AM/FM Tuner Section of this Owners Manual when
performing the following steps.
1. Tune to a weak AM station near 600kHz on the AM
band. Using a small NON - METALLIC screwdriver,
adjust the
600kHz
trans-
former L1
for maxi-
mum sig-
nal
strength.
Refer to
Figure 21.
2. Tune to a weak AM station near 1400kHz on the AM
band. Using a small NON-METALLIC screwdriver,
adjust the 1400kHz capacitor trimmer C1 for maxi-
mum signal strength.

The MX132 Setup program allows you to set the wakeup
Volume Level for Zone B. The level is expressed in per-
centage of maximum available volume.
1. Press and hold the front panel Setup pushbutton ap-
proximately three seconds to enter the Setup Mode.
The front panel display will indicate SETUP and the
MAIN SYSTEM SETUP MENU will appear on the
Monitor/TV screen. Refer to Figure 6.
2. Press Number 8 pushbutton on the Remote Control to
access ZONE B VOLUME PRESET MENU, which
will appear on the screen. Refer to Figure 20.
Note: The very first time the ZONE B VOLUME PRESET
MENU is accessed, the screen will indicate the factory
default settings.
3. Press a Level Up or Down pushbutton for the desired
Zone B Volume Preset level.
4. After the ZONE B VOLUME PRESET has been ad-
justed, press pushbutton E on the Remote Control to
exit to the MAIN SYSTEM SETUP MENU.
5. Press E a second time to exit the MAIN SYSTEM
SETUP MENU and the Adjustment Acceptance screen
will appear. Refer to Figure 7.
6. If you are satisfied with adjustments you have made,
press Remote Control pushbutton number 1 for YES.
The changes will be saved in memory and you will exit
the Setup Mode to normal operation.
7. If you are not satisfied with the adjustments or changes
you have made, press number 0 on the remote control
for NO. The Setup Mode will exit to normal operation
without saving the changes in memory.
